The Redondo Beach Art Group (RBAG) is dedicated to promoting the Arts, Art Education and Public Art in the South Bay. RBAG Is looking forward to establishing a Creative Arts Center in Redondo Beach -- a cultural center which will enhance the lives of South Bay residents, visitors, and businesses. The Group is a non-profit organization and welcomes tax deductible donations towards the Creative Arts Center. Membership in RBAG is open to all artists and art enthusiasts.

RBAG was founded in 2003 to create and promote artistic discussion, to provide camaraderie and encouragement to the artistic community, to collaborate and to support the visual arts in the South Bay. RBAG has participated in, sponsored and organized many art events in the South Bay (view past events).

///////////////////////////////////////  CA 101  \\\\\\\\\\\\\\\\\\\\\\\\\\\\\\\\\\\\\\\

 CA101 2013 will take place at the AES Power Plant located off CA101 on the California coast.
The dormant structure has a soaring ceiling, expanse of windows, open space and unique backdrop 
of the original equipment. It is the size of a football field with brick red floors and mint turbines.
A unique Industrial Cathedral. 

 This year’s exhibit is an unparalleled venue for artists from California’s Oregon border 
to San Diego to share and exchange their creative impressions of life today in California.

In order to achieve a quality exhibition, CA101 will be juried carefully and curated with care,
taking advantage of this unique space.
 

 Our wish is to understand and appreciate the work of artists working in California.
We would like to explore how living in California shapes the work artists are creating today.
 

CA101 2013 is being sponsored by the Friends of Redondo Beach Arts,
Redondo Beach Art Group and AES Redondo Beach. If you have any questions regarding the show,

——————————  PAINT WALES WORKSHOP  ——————————

 

 Tuesday, September 24 – Monday, September 30, 2013
 

 

 

Cost: approximately $1750 and includes hotel & breakfast, (with two people per room), 
minibus transport and r/t rail ticket from London Euston Station to Prestatyn, North Wales. 
This is the main rail line to the Holyhead ferry for Ireland.

 

 


Wales has the most castles per country, and we will visit at least Conwy, Caernarfon and Beaumaris castles. 
We will also visit the magnificent Snowdonia National Park and Llangollen.

 

Not far away are the cities of Chester and Liverpool.

 

Does NOT include flights and transport from USA to UK, other meals, some entrance fees, insurance, tips, etc.

 

Probable maximum number 8 or 10.

Membership

The Redondo Beach Art Group meets on the first Wednesday of each month at 7pm at the Redondo Beach Historic Library, 309 Esplanade, Redondo Beach CA 90277.

Membership is open to all artists and art enthusiasts. Membership dues are $30 per year due in January, although you can join anytime during the year.
